#[non_exhaustive]pub struct ProfileLine {
pub label: String,
pub call_depth: usize,
pub table_heights_start: VMTableHeights,
pub table_heights_stop: VMTableHeights,
}Expand description
A single line in a profile report for profiling Triton programs.
Fields (Non-exhaustive)§
This struct is marked as non-exhaustive
Non-exhaustive structs could have additional fields added in future. Therefore, non-exhaustive structs cannot be constructed in external crates using the traditional
Struct { .. } syntax; cannot be matched against without a wildcard ..; and struct update syntax will not work.label: String§call_depth: usize§table_heights_start: VMTableHeightsTable heights at the start of this span, i.e., right after the
corresponding call
instruction was executed.
table_heights_stop: VMTableHeightsTable heights at the end of this span, i.e., right after the
corresponding return
or recurse_or_return
(in “return” mode) was executed
